Climbing plants
Round-leaved Spindle-tree, Tubular-leaved Red-pouch
Celastrus orbiculatus Thunb.
Japan, China. A fast-growing, very robust climber reaching up to 12 meters, an undemanding vine for sunny sites with green ovate leaves. The flowers are pale green and inconspicuous in June. All the more striking are the yellow fruits which, after splitting open, reveal red seeds. They ripen in September and persist until January. A very valuable decoration for vases. This climbing plant makes few demands on soil and site, and is well suited for adorning pergolas and covered alleys.
